The Ferguson Group
The Ferguson Group had its beginnings in Aberdeenshire, Scotland, over 35 years ago. Today it has grown
to be one of the worlds leading suppliers of containers, accommodation and workspace modules and
accommodation service vessels to the offshore energy industry.
The main bases are located in UK, Norway, Australia, Singapore and UAE.
Today the Ferguson Group supplies high quality DNV 2.7-1/EN 12079 containers and modules around the
world, working closely with partners in many areas, extending the global reach of the Ferguson name and
products.
All containers and modules are manufactured to DNV 2.7-1/EN 12079 standards and the Ferguson Group
has pioneered the acceptance of these safety standards in every area in which it operates.

Containers, Tanks and Baskets
Ferguson Group (formerly Ferguson Seacabs) is one of the worlds largest specialist providers of
offshore containers, baskets, tanks and associated lifting equipment and has been servicing the
offshore industry since 1976. The company operates a web enabled comprehensive Container
Management System (CMS) which allows for the tracking of all containers, baskets and tanks
throughout the global rental eet. This enables the effective management of container testing
and re-certication requirements, in accordance with DNV 2.7-1/EN 12079 and local regulatory
requirements.
Accommodation and Workspace Modules
Ferguson Group (formerly Ferguson Modular) provides a range of A60 DNV 2.7-1 offshore
accommodation and workspace modules to the global oil, gas and renewable energy industries. The
product range contains several designs for offshore accommodation modules along with workspace
modules including ofces, laboratories, test cabins, MWD and LWD cabins, mud logging cabins,
coffee shops, tea shacks and workshops. Ancillary modules such as recreation rooms, gymnasiums,
locker rooms, galley/mess rooms, laundry rooms and medic suites can be supplied to supplement
larger accommodation complexes.
Accommodation Service Vessel
The Groups accommodation service vessel, ASV Pioneer, is a versatile offshore accommodation
solution which is unique in the marketplace. Built to the highest quality and safety standards it
offers unprecedented exibility of accommodation conguration and a large 1100m2 open deck
space capable of a multitude of uses including offshore oil and gas, renewable energy and salvage
operations. ASV Pioneer is currently congured for 120 POB, but can provide accommodation for
up to 220 POB in well appointed en-suite rooms, and is complete with ofce, galley, mess, medical
and recreational facilities, to provide an ideal living and working environment. The accommodation
complex is manufactured to DNV 2.7-1/EN 12079 standards and accredited by DNV.
Blue
REFRIGERATION OFFSHORE
IceBlue Refrigeration Offshore, a member of the Ferguson Group, provides offshore refrigerated/
chiller modules for transportation and storage. All units are manufactured to and certied in
accordance with DNV 2.7-1/EN 12079 standards and are available from Ferguson Group worldwide
bases. With short lead times, IceBlue Refrigeration Offshores global eet of refrigerated containers
are offered in sizes from 2.5m, 3m and 6m units providing refrigeration and freezing solutions. The
6m dual zone module offers movable bulk head to provide two compartments; one set as freezer/
chiller and one for storing non-perishable goods in ambient temperature.

Manufacturing
Designed-in Excellence
All accommodation and workspace modules are designed and built in-house to the latest specications
and, with control over the production process, quality of the end product and delivery schedules is
guaranteed.
All Ferguson Group modules offer the following:
s A60
s DNV 2.7-1 / EN 12079
s Light (15,000kg for the largest 10.3m fully serviced accommodation module)
s Smaller footprint for tight deck spaces
s Strong can be stacked up to four high
s Linkable/adaptable to form accommodation complexes
s Flexible interiors for accommodation and workspace modules
s NORSOK standards also available for the Norwegian market
s A variety of Zone 1, Zone 2 and safe area modules are available
From the wide standard range of module sizes, Ferguson Groups unique customised standardisation
gives every customer the benets of the standard module customised internally to their exact
requirements. When hiring from the standard range a t-out team is ready to adjust internal layouts if
necessary to suit your specic needs.
